Demand for options to bank financing

With banking institutions asking on average 18% for borrowing through overdrafts or charge cards, it really is no real surprise that individuals are searching around for cheaper resources of finance. During the time that is same are making a pathetic return, plus in some situations are going to just simply simply take more danger to enhance earnings. Could peer-to-peer (P2P) lending be described as a solution that is mutually beneficial?

Perhaps, nonetheless it needs to be approached with caution as P2P financing just isn’t managed and there isn’t any guarantee you are going to back get your money. Through the borrower’s point of view P2P could be a great way to obtain finance for little jobs or even to carry an individual more than a hard spot. However the rates of interest may possibly not be far lower than you’ll find at a commercial bank. The bonus is the fact that personal loan providers may think about that loan of just a few hundred pounds the place where a bank wouldn’t normally be interested.

P2P lending originated from the usa, where it really is a believed become well well worth $1 billion, with loan volume likely to triple as banking institutions continue steadily to tighten up their policies. Zopa could be the highest profile P2P loan provider in the united kingdom and has now been with us.

To cut back the danger to loan providers Zopa checks possible borrowers’ credit files and places them into risk groups. Loan providers determine how much they wish to provide, at just just exactly what price also to which group of danger.

To help keep dangers Zopa that is manageable will provide lower amounts to specific borrowers – and this is not actually an upgraded for a financial loan. A lender offering £500 or maybe more might have their money spread across at the very least 50 borrowers, whom access lawfully contracts that are binding their loan providers. If repayments are missed, a collections agency utilizes the recovery that is same due to the fact high-street banking institutions. Zopa’s cut is really a £130 deal cost and a 1% yearly servicing cost to loan providers.

But, Zopa is unregulated and loan providers haven’t any comeback if your borrower defaults, apart from using the debtor to court. This isn’t probably be practicable since if borrowers were financially appear they most likely wouldn’t be borrowing this way within the beginning. Zopa claims the typical return on loans within the last year is 6.5% internet of fees, although not money owed.

Other portals

FundingCircle can be a portal that is online investors will make loans right to smaller businesses in amounts no more than ВЈ20 to spread the danger. The typical return is around 8.4%, based on the company. The thing is having your cash back, since these loans might not have a fixed term. Loans can, nevertheless, be offered with other investors to realise your hard earned money.

Another internet site that sets wealthier investors and small enterprises in touch is ThinCats. Loan providers set their interest prices and work out their investment choices. Borrowers could possibly get loans between ВЈ50,000 and ВЈ1 million at fixed prices of 7-15% for 6 months to 5 years. All ThinCats loans are supported by debentures or individual guarantees to a comparable standard that a bank need. The investment that is minimum ВЈ1,000.

Developments in america

P2P websites in america such as for instance Wikiloan acknowledge that almost all their possible borrowers will never pass mainstream credit checks. ‘More than 85% of users trying to get peer-to-peer loans aren’t credit worthy,’ says Marco Garibaldi, leader of Wikiloan.

P2P financing keeps growing fast with several different types. Lendingclub, as an example, lends mostly to those who find themselves a good credit danger and would be eligible for a mortgage anyhow. Prosper offers creditworthy borrowers with specific and institutional investors. Its outcomes revealed a 367% year-on-year escalation in loans.

Most of the banks drive this growth’ clampdown on riskier lending, plus some is idealistically inspired. Prosper makes no key of the help when it comes to Occupy Wall Street demonstration, which seeks to split the your hands on banking institutions within the United States management.
